Product Overview
The HP 717492-B21 is a 2-Port 10Gb/s SFP+ PCIe 2.0 x8 Network Interface Card. It provides high-speed Ethernet connectivity for servers and workstations requiring 10 Gigabit performance.
Technical Information
| Interface | PCIe 2.0 x8 |
| Number of Ports | 2 |
| Port Type | SFP+ |
Additional Specifications
| Data Transfer Rate | 10 Gb/s per port |
| Network Type | 10 Gigabit Ethernet (10GbE) |
| Manufacturer | HP |
Product Description
The HP 717492-B21 is a high-performance network adapter designed to deliver 10 Gigabit Ethernet connectivity. Featuring two SFP+ ports, it allows for the connection of high-speed fiber optic transceivers, enabling data transfer rates of up to 10 Gb/s per port. This makes it an ideal solution for demanding network environments that require significant bandwidth. Built with a PCIe 2.0 x8 interface, this card provides ample bandwidth to support the high throughput of 10GbE connections, ensuring that the network adapter does not become a bottleneck for server or workstation performance. The dual-port design offers redundancy, increased throughput, or the ability to connect to multiple network segments simultaneously. This network card is suitable for a wide range of applications, including high-performance computing, data-intensive storage solutions, server virtualization, and enterprise networking. Its robust design and high-speed capabilities make it a critical component for modern data centers and high-end workstations.
